tests: simplify AT_PARSER_CHECK usage
Currently the caller must specify the ./ prefix to its command. Let's avoid that: it will be nicer to read, make it easier to have a version that works for Java and C/C++. * tests/local.at (AT_PARSER_CHECK): Prefix the command with ./. Adjust callers.
